Donkey’s information is entered into a proprietary … WebJun 25, 2012 · Burro is Spanish for donkey; donkeys and burros are the same thing. The BLM says that as of February 29, 2012, there were 5,841 wild burros living on BLM-managed rangelands in Arizona, California, Nevada, Oregon and Utah. (There are 3,194 in wild donkeys in Arizona alone). They say that’s way too many for the range to support, … does mount kilimanjaro still have snow https://ocrraceway.com

WebMar 17, 2024 · The California State Legislature enacted Fish and Game Code section 4600 to make it unlawful to kill, wound, capture or have in possession any wild donkey, known legally as an “undomesticated burro,” with a few exceptions noted below. WebNov 22, 2024 · “Burro” is just the Spanish word for donkey. Fun fact: “Burrito” means “little donkey” and was probably coined because of the similarities between a stuffed taco and a stuffed pack on the back of a donkey. 3. What are male and female donkeys called? Male donkeys are called jacks. Female donkeys are called jennies or jennets. 4.
